Job Title : Parts Breakdown

Job Description

This role involves the removal of cut parts from large sheets of steel, aluminum, and other metals. The job is repetitive and requires standing for extended periods. When not engaged in this task, employees will perform various duties throughout the warehouse.

Responsibilities

  • Complete basic, routine tasks following detailed instructions.
  • Move inventory or equipment, fill customer orders, pull material from racks, unload incoming materials, load trucks and customer vehicles, and help maintain warehouse upkeep.
  • Receive and place / return items into stock inventory locations.
  • Pull and assemble orders based on work / shipping orders or other documentation.
  • Tag materials for proper identification and complete all required documentation.
  • Move materials from receiving or production areas to storage or other designated areas using a forklift, side loader, or crane.
  • Operate a yard truck for loading and unloading trailers.
  • Maintain a clean, safe, and orderly work area.
  • Sort and place materials on racks, shelves, or in bins according to predetermined sequences such as size, type, or product code.
  • Conduct spot checks on inventory, complete daily and ad hoc checks for proper tagging of materials as directed.
  • Report any irregularities to the supervisor for direction.
  • Restock materials.
  • Occasionally drive a motor vehicle (non-DOT truck) for local deliveries and parts pick-ups.
  • Ensure compliance with applicable safety and quality standards.
  • Perform other duties and responsibilities assigned by management.

    Work Environment

    The facility is non-climate controlled, and employees must wear jeans or work pants. Shorts, sweats, or leggings are not allowed. Shifts are Monday through Friday, with the option for overtime, and flexibility is required for early starts and weekend work.
